Horne goal lifts Centre to 10th win of season

Senior David Horne (Louisville, Ky.) connected on a penalty kick midway through the second half and the defense earned its seventh shutout of the season as the Centre College men's soccer team defeated Elmhurst College 1-0, Thursday, Oct. 12, in Terre Haute, Ind.

With the win, the Colonels winning streak extends to seven straight matches, and pushes their overall record to 10-1 on the year, while Elmhurst drops to 3-6-4 overall. The match, which was postponed earlier in the year and moved to a central location, was played on the campus of the Rose-Hulman Institute of Technology.

The two teams battled through a scoreless first half with neither team able to find the back of the net. Through 45 minutes, Centre out shot Elmhurst 11-3 and held a 6-1 advantage in corner kicks.

The match remained scoreless until the 74:31 mark in the second half when Horne was awarded a penalty kick and connected for his fifth goal of the season for the game-winner.

The Colonels also controlled much of the second half out shooting Elmhurst 11-4 along with a 5-2 edge in corner kicks. Junior Chris Creger (Mount Pleasant, S.C.) earned the shutout win in goal for Centre. Creger stopped all four of the shots he faced.

The Colonels will return home Saturday, Oct. 14, to host Asbury College. The non-conference match is slated to begin at 7 p.m. in Danville, Ky.
